Numpy 32位Miniconda python 3.5 Matplotlib崩溃。视窗7

Numpy 32位Miniconda python 3.5 Matplotlib崩溃。视窗7,numpy,matplotlib,crash,anaconda,miniconda,Numpy,Matplotlib,Crash,Anaconda,Miniconda,有很多类似的帖子,但没有一篇像我能找到的这个构建那么简单 我是Python新手,正在尝试重新创建MATLAB功能,所以我显然想要pyplot 我从头开始安装,如下所示: 32位miniconda.exe pycharm 5.0(也使用了4.5.4) pycharm解释器=3.5.0,位于C:\Users\xxx.xxxxxxx\AppData\Local\Continuum\Miniconda3.exe 在pycharm终端中运行: 康达安装numpy。。。y…完成了 康达安装scipy。。。

有很多类似的帖子,但没有一篇像我能找到的这个构建那么简单

我是Python新手,正在尝试重新创建MATLAB功能,所以我显然想要pyplot

我从头开始安装,如下所示:

32位miniconda.exe

pycharm 5.0(也使用了4.5.4)

pycharm解释器=3.5.0,位于C:\Users\xxx.xxxxxxx\AppData\Local\Continuum\Miniconda3.exe

在pycharm终端中运行:

康达安装numpy。。。y…完成了

康达安装scipy。。。y…完成了

conda安装matplotlib。。。y…完成了

Pycharm在项目窗口底部显示“索引”后,我运行:

import matplotlib.pyplot as plt
plt.plot([1, 2, 3, 4])
plt.ylabel('some numbers')
plt.show()
我现在可以导入numpy、matplotlib和scipy,没有任何错误

上面的代码会弹出一个弹出窗口,显示:

Python已经停止工作 一个问题导致程序停止正常工作。请关闭程序。 有选择权 -关闭程序 -调试程序

在Python3.5或Pycharm中以脚本的形式运行此脚本时,我得到了相同的结果

如果我选择关闭程序,窗口将消失,pycharm将继续运行而不显示绘图

如果选择调试Microsoft Visual Studio,则默认情况下会打开它,显示以下内容:

python.exe中0x5BD64A82(libpng16.dll)处未处理的异常:0xC0000005:访问冲突写入位置0x0D000140

有选择: -中断 -继续

这两种选择似乎对我都没有多大帮助,但我不熟悉VS

无论我做什么,我都看不到类似情节的东西

有什么想法吗?我错过什么了吗?我真的不想使用Python2.7(如其他地方所建议的),因为我不需要向后兼容,但如果这是唯一的修复方法,我会尝试一下

提前谢谢


Pat.

matplotlib.get\u backend()提供了什么?另外,试着给完整的anacanda发行版一个try和/或我把它放到anaconda邮件列表上。“import matplotlib.pyplot as plt print(plt.get_backend())”给出:Qt4Agg我不知道这意味着什么id
conda
install
pyqt
qt
?@tcaswell我运行了“conda install pyqt”和“conda install qt”,两者都返回了“已安装所有请求的软件包”。只是在完整的anaconda环境中运行了此操作,并且出现了相同的故障